so far both males are doing good caring for their fry. the halfmoon fry look to be a tad older than the delta tail fry. i wasnt home when they hatched, but im assuming they are around 12 hours apart or so. there are far more in the delta spawn, and im a bit concerned about the halfmoons, since i watched the pair spawn and there were a lot of eggs, but i dont see as many fry as i thought i would, but then, the water is pretty dark and the lighting in my room is awful. i may do a partial water change tomorrow. he did very well with his first spawn, but im hoping this time around he didnt decide to eat them. i might remove him earlier than i used to, just in case. the fry will be about 3 days old which is right around when they start free swimming anyways.

as for where they will go when they are ready? i plan to keep some, the others i will sell to my local fish store. they take excellent care of their betta and make sure they go to good homes (they always ask a lot of questions to make sure they know how to care for them properly). i just updated my site a little. there is only a page for the delta tail until i can get a better picture of the half moon fry.

i am limited to how many pages i can make on that website until i pay for pro, which i cant afford right now. so i am only putting up spawn logs for those that i still have. the others have died. the steel blue half moons page has been hidden until i can get better photos of the fry.

some of my bettas are random chance, i just happen to have luck with stopping by places when they are just getting an order in! lol. well, i know when my local store gets theirs in and i try to hit it, but everywhere else is just kinda stumbling in and finding a neat looking betta. the black lace, red wash delta and the two crowntail females were from petco bettas, as well as my big ear delta that is in my community tank at my fiances. all of the other fishies are from my local store.

also, i love the black lace as well, but hes got some issues so i may not breed him, as much as i want to. his anal fin is really long, he has a spoonhead, and his tail looks to be a mild rosetail, which could bring scale deformities. i could breed him, but i dont know how these issues would affect the fry.

3000, he sounds gorgeous. About the heater,no, I didn't have one. The room I stayed in stayed a constant 80 degrees or higher which sucked because it was hot, but they thrived in there. We just had a situation where we had to move out immediately and we're stuck in a basement which is freezing cold. My boys are all around sick, and I can't get heaters for all of them, but perhaps I will get a divider or two and put a heater in my large tank so they can at least get a bit more healthy.
